**Core Concept**
Abscess formation is a localized collection of pus, typically resulting from a bacterial infection, and is characterized by the accumulation of dead cells, bacteria, and other debris. This process is facilitated by the host's inflammatory response, which attempts to contain and eliminate the infectious agent. The type of microorganism involved can influence the likelihood and characteristics of abscess formation.
**Why the Correct Answer is Right**
Staphylococcus aureus is a gram-positive bacterium commonly associated with skin and soft tissue infections, including abscesses. This bacterium produces virulence factors such as coagulase, which helps to create a protective environment for the bacteria within the abscess. The host's immune response to S. aureus can lead to the formation of a localized abscess, rather than a more diffuse infection. The bacteria's ability to produce a thick capsule and to evade neutrophil killing mechanisms also contributes to abscess formation.
**Why Each Wrong Option is Incorrect**
* **Option A:** While Streptococcus pyogenes can cause severe skin infections, it is less commonly associated with abscess formation compared to S. aureus. S. pyogenes tends to cause more diffuse infections, such as cellulitis or erysipelas.
* **Option B:** Pseudomonas aeruginosa can cause a variety of infections, including skin and soft tissue infections, but it is not typically associated with abscess formation. Instead, P. aeruginosa often causes more diffuse infections or infections with a characteristic "greenish" discharge.
* **Option D:** While Escherichia coli can cause a range of infections, it is not typically associated with abscess formation in the skin and soft tissues. E. coli is more commonly associated with urinary tract infections or intra-abdominal infections.
